2. Pledge Fundraising

Fundraising for schools is always a challenge, especially when the same traditional methods are used year after year. One fundraising idea that has proven to be successful is pledge fundraising.

This method involves students raising pledges from family and friends for a predetermined activity, such as a walk-a-thon or a read-a-thon. Not only is this method a fun and engaging way for students to raise funds for their school, but it also promotes teamwork and school spirit.

Pledge fundraising can also be easily customized to fit any school’s unique needs and goals. So why not try something new and switch up your school’s fundraising routine with pledge fundraising?

6. Bingo Day

Bingo Day is the perfect fundraising idea for schools looking for a fun and simple way to raise funds. This event is not only a great way to bring the community together, but it can also bring in substantial donations.

Students and parents alike can spend a weekend afternoon playing bingo and winning great prizes. By charging a small admission fee or selling concession items, the school can raise significant funds for important school programs and activities.

Bingo Day is a low-cost event to organize, making it a cost-effective option for small schools with limited resources. Overall, Bingo Day promises to be a win-win solution for both the school and the community.

7. 50/50 Raffle

Fundraising is an essential part of schools across the country. However, finding unique and engaging ideas can be challenging. One great option to consider is a 50/50 raffle.

This type of fundraising event involves selling tickets to the school community, with half of the proceeds going to the winner and the other half going to the school.

Not only is it a fun and exciting way for students and faculty to come together in support of their local school, but it can also raise a significant amount of money. 

Whether it’s for a new playground, classroom supplies, or even scholarships, a 50/50 raffle is an excellent fundraising idea that can help make a real difference in the lives of students.
